Description

App Inventor was developed by MIT to teach students programming in a fun context that every modern student understands, mobile phones!

My students love this unit. It allows them to move at their own pace, be creative and solve problems. For many of them it is their first introduction to the world of programming.

I first created this resource in 2012 but have recently updated it for App Inventor 2. The original free version was downloaded over 30,000 times with consistently exceptional feedback so I have written this new version as a commercial product.

The unit contains:
8 editable workbooks each between 4 and 8 pages (Serif PagePlus)
8 pdf copies of the workbooks
Completed app files for you to upload and try
Teaching notes
Pupil files required for each workbook
An app design sheet
